摘 要:目的观察双歧杆菌三联活菌联合阿奇霉素治疗对百日咳患儿的临床疗效。方法回顾性分析2022年7月至2024年9月在嘉兴市妇幼保健院儿科就诊的百日咳患儿临床资料。根据治疗方法分为常规治疗组(仅使用阿奇霉素)和联合治疗组(阿奇霉素联合应用双歧杆菌三联活菌)。观察指标包括临床疗效、血清炎症因子[白细胞介素-10(IL-10)、反应蛋白(CRP)、肿瘤坏死因子-α(TNF-α)]、免疫功能(CD3^(+)T细胞、CD4^(+)T细胞、CD8^(+)T细胞和CD4^(+)/CD8^(+)T细胞比值)水平及不良反应。结果研究共纳入103例患者,常规治疗组48例,联合治疗组55例。治疗14 d后,两组总有效率差异无统计学意义(P>0.05)。与常规治疗组相比,联合治疗组血清IL-10、TNF-α、CRP、CD8^(+)细胞水平显著低于常规治疗组(P<0.05);CD3^(+)T、CD4^(+)T细胞水平和CD4^(+)/CD8^(+)T细胞比值显著高于常规治疗组(P<0.05)。两组不良反应发生率差异无统计学意义(P>0.05)。结论联合应用双歧杆菌三联活菌不影响阿奇霉素治疗小儿百日咳的临床疗效和安全性,且可通过调节免疫炎症反应发挥协同治疗作用。Objective To investigate the clinical efficacy of combined therapy with bifidobacterium triple viable bacteria and azithromycin in children with pertussis.Methods Clinical data of children with pertussis treated at the Department of Pediatrics,Jiaxing Maternal and Child Health Hospital from July 2022 to September 2024 were retrospectively analyzed.Patients were divided into the conventional treatment group(azithromycin alone)and the combination treatment group(azithromycin combined with bifidobacterium triple viable bacteria).Observation indicators included clinical efficacy,serum inflammatory factors(IL-10,CRP and TNF-α),immune function levels(CD3^(+)T cells,CD4^(+)T cells,CD8^(+)T cells,and CD4^(+)/CD8^(+)T cells ratio),and adverse reactions.Results A total of 103 patients were included in the study,with 48 in the conventional treatment group and 55 in the combination treatment group.After 14 d of treatment,there was no statistically significant difference in total effective rate between the two groups(P>0.05).Compared with the conventional treatment group,the serum IL-10,TNF-α,CRP and CD8^(+)cell levels of the combination treatment group were significantly lower than those of the conventional treatment group(P<0.05);the CD3^(+)T,CD4^(+)T cell levels and CD4^(+)/CD8^(+)T cell ratio were significantly higher than those of the conventional treatment group(P<0.05).There was no significant difference in the occurrence of adverse reactions between the two groups(P>0.05).Conclusion The combined application of bifidobacterium triple viable bacteria does not affect the clinical efficacy and safety of azithromycin in treating pediatric pertussis,and exerts a synergistic therapeutic effect through regulating immune inflammatory responses.
